众 (zhòng) - crowd & multitude
众Tone 4
zhòng | 6 strokes | radical: 人
众 · zhòng
crowd;
multitude;
many;
numerous;
the masses;
public.

Idioms
- Many mouths make a great noise(众口铄金)
- All in one voice(众口一词)
- The crowd raises a tree(众擎易举)
- Many hands make light work(众人拾柴火焰高)
- Out of the common run(与众不同)
Cultural background
FAQ- The character visually depicts three people (从从), symbolizing a crowd or multitude.
- In Confucian thought, the 'will of the people' (民意) is often referenced as 众意.
- Represents collectivism and unity in Chinese cultural values.
